Major Update #3 is now live! As promised in our development roadmap, we're continuing to overhaul the environments. This update includes new locations, structures, and let's just say... some strange things! Once we're satisfied with the environmental additions, we'll focus on enhancing the finer details. Our goal is to make the forest and everything in it look realistic, weathered, and deteriorated. We want players to wonder, "Wait, what happened here?" and to keep you constantly on edge, always questioning your surroundings.

Before diving into the changelog, I want to address the current quality of scares. We know they aren’t where we want them to be just yet. Please remember, we're a small team of indie developers, and DON’T SCREAM is still in early access. By purchasing our game, you're not just buying into something early; you’re actively helping us refine it before the full release. Rest assured, all aspects of our scares—including models, animations, effects, and sounds—will be significantly enhanced or reworked. We’re taking a methodical approach to our updates, with upcoming ones set to focus more on improving these scares.

Encountered bugs or have feedback? Connect with us on our Steam Forums or Discord. Thank you! Here’s a recap of what’s planned in our development roadmap:

DEVELOPMENT ROADMAP

  • Continue improving performance for smoother gameplay, especially optimizing for medium and high graphic settings.

  • Significantly enhance scares, focusing on models, animations, effects, and sounds, and improving the tension and buildup of each scare.

  • Introduce new objectives and more incentives to encourage exploration.

  • Add new enemies that pose a real threat to the player—soon, your own scream won’t be the only thing to fear!

  • Refine the user interface to make it more intuitive and immersive.

  • Completely redesign the sound for a more immersive auditory experience.

  • Further improve microphone calibration and implementation.

  • Enhance environmental storytelling.

  • Introduce environmental dangers.

With all that said, we hope you appreciate the direction we’re taking DON’T SCREAM. What started as a UE5 horror experiment is evolving into a richer game experience, thanks to your support. Now, without further ado, here are the patch notes!

PATCH NOTES

MAJOR CHANGES

  • Added Church environment and leading pathways

  • Added Sanatorium with extended road to Old Farm House

  • Added Cornfield behind Old Farm House

  • Added Junkyard with pathways from the Main Road and Abandoned Shack

  • Added details to Powerplant

  • Added Strange Doors in the forest that now have a purpose

  • Added many new details to the enviroments and key locations

  • Added fog and more improved lighting to many areas

  • Modified lighting and fog in Minimart

  • Modified lighting and fog in Cemetery

  • Modified Oil Freighter Wreckage scenery

  • Modified water and fog in Swamp

  • Modified Lighting in Old Farm House

  • Added retro-reflective trail markers to help players find their way to key locations

  • Added on-screen compass and location to help in finding specific locations

  • Added new battery system to force players to keep moving and exploring areas, batteries found at many key locations in the forest

  • Added new audio system to allow better control and optimisation of sounds in the world

  • Added a few new scares and improved audio on many pre-existing ones

  • Improved overall game performance, especially at higher screen resolutions

  • Improved collisions of many world props and environment areas
